He who fights, can lose. He who doesn’t fight, has already lost.

What’s the meaning of this quote?

Quote Meaning: This quote encapsulates the essence of courage and the inevitability of facing challenges in life. It suggests that in any endeavor or conflict, there are two potential outcomes.

Firstly, “He who fights, can lose” implies that when you actively engage in something, whether it’s a battle, a competition, or simply pursuing a goal, there is a risk of failure. Fighting here symbolizes putting in effort, taking risks, and confronting obstacles. Just like in a battle, victory is not guaranteed, and there is a chance of defeat.

However, the second part of the quote, “He who doesn’t fight, has already lost,” emphasizes that opting out or refusing to participate is also a form of defeat. By not taking action, you deny yourself the opportunity to succeed or overcome challenges. You resign yourself to a passive state of defeat because you never gave yourself a chance to win.

In essence, this quote encourages individuals to embrace the uncertainty of life’s battles and challenges. It reminds us that the mere act of participating and giving our best effort, even if it comes with the possibility of failure, is a courageous and worthwhile endeavor. It underscores the importance of taking action and not letting fear of failure paralyze us into inaction. In this way, it motivates us to face life head-on, knowing that true defeat only occurs when we choose not to engage at all.

Who said the quote?

The quote “He who fights, can lose. He who doesn’t fight, has already lost.” was said by Bertolt Brecht (Quotes). Bertolt Brecht, a renowned poet and playwright, was a key figure in 20th-century theater and known for his influential epic theater techniques.
